Autogenous vaccines for aquaculture have become a norm since the last few years. This could be reasoned with them playing an important role in controlling bacterial diseases. Plus, the companies dealing in veterinary pharmaceuticals are into provision of customized autogenous vaccines for specific pathogens. Europe dominates this market as regulations regarding nurturing the aquamarine population have become stringent.

Additionally, quality of aquafeed is a matter of concern everywhere. This calls for commercial aquaculture vaccines. They have, in fact, overridden antibiotics in fish aquaculture farming. The latest trend herein is that of 3rd-generation DNA vaccines getting commercialized as they are reported to be effective in the long run.

Smallpox vaccines have already done more than their job. In other words, this ailment is almost non-existent all across. Vaccinia virus causes smallpox. Though experts state that the effect of smallpox vaccine lasts for 5-6 years, the disease itself has become history now. At present, ACAM2000 is the sole licensed vaccine available for smallpox in the US that the US FDA has approved.

Swine flu is another contagious disease. It is commonly termed as “H1N1 flu”, more so as swine H1N1 virus causes it. The symptoms include body ache, red watery eyes, cold, cough, and discomfort in general. The entire respiratory system goes for a toss on contracting H1N1 flu. Intramuscular H1N1 vaccines are administered, though intradermal and intranasal vaccines are also preferred by certain people. Also, the vaccine could be live attenuated or inactivated.
